Today, my oldest graduates from high school. Gratitude is the correct word for me today. The emotions are running high... but somehow this one struck me. I am grateful that he is a bright, handsome funny young man and my son at the same time. Although I am sad for what drug use has done to our family... I am grateful to have a family to love and care about.

I am very clear today that although I made choices to end a marriage, it was not that decision that caused the pain in our lives. It was drugs, their power and the decisions to use that lead to the mess that was our lives.

Today, I am no longer mired in that mess day to day. The drug use and its last effects still have grips on our family... but I am clearer about the role I played in all of this mess.

So, today I am grateful for the strength to change and grateful for the love and support that has allowed me to move forward. I am sad too... but mostly I am looking forward to today and watching my baby get ready to move on and tackle the world.

Congratulations to your son and to you too as you have "graduated" to acceptance. You made a difficult decision but as things settle and you are out of the front row seat with addiction, I know you are finding some serenity in your life.

I have found that gratitude truly helps me move forward. Even when life is stressful, if I can focus on what I am grateful for rather than what I feel unhappy about, I can move from a sense of stagnation to one of choice and opportunity.
